Alienated (Alienated #1) by Melissa Landers: Review


RATING: 5/5 stars!
 
Author: Melissa Landers
Publisher: Disney-Hyperion
Release Date: February 4, 2014
Find it on Goodreads here!
 
SUMMARY (from Goodreads):
 
Two years ago, the aliens made contact. Now Cara Sweeney is going to be sharing a bathroom with one of them.

Handpicked to host the first-ever L’eihr exchange student, Cara thinks her future is set. Not only does she get a free ride to her dream college, she’ll have inside information about the mysterious L’eihrs that every journalist would kill for. Cara’s blog following is about to skyrocket.

Still, Cara isn’t sure what to think when she meets Aelyx. Humans and L’eihrs have nearly identical DNA, but cold, infuriatingly brilliant Aelyx couldn’t seem more alien. She’s certain about one thing, though: no human boy is this good-looking.

But when Cara's classmates get swept up by anti-L'eihr paranoia, Midtown High School suddenly isn't safe anymore. Threatening notes appear in Cara's locker, and a police officer has to escort her and Aelyx to class.

Cara finds support in the last person she expected. She realizes that Aelyx isn’t just her only friend; she's fallen hard for him. But Aelyx has been hiding the truth about the purpose of his exchange, and its potentially deadly consequences. Soon Cara will be in for the fight of her life—not just for herself and the boy she loves, but for the future of her planet.
 
REVIEW:
 
Before I start my review, can we just take a moment to appreciate this cover? The font! The colors! The people!
 

Now that that is out of the way....ALIENATED was absolutely fantastic. I wasn't quite sure about it at first, but as I delved more into the story, I grew to love the story (and Aelyx) even more.

"Hips of that width are likely to pass live offspring without complications."

Aelyx was one of the best male leads I have read in a long time. He was so awkward at times, but that made him even more attractive than he already was. And he was hilarious. That quote about the hips, though. *dies of laughter*

Cara was really awesome too. Most of the time, I find the female leads in books to be annoying at times, but I never found Cara annoying. She was so refreshing. I loved that she never took crap from anyone, especially her annoying ex-boyfriend.

The world Melissa created was absolutely fantastic too. Most of the book still took place on earth, but I found the planet L'eihr fascinating. I hope we get to see more of it in the next book!

Overall, ALIENATED is a must read for sci-fi fans...and romance lovers...actually, everyone should read it. It will not disappoint!

CONTENT: Kissing, talk of going "all the way", but no sex ever happens; no swearing I can recall, and hardly any violence.
